Batting Prowess: Miami Marlins vs. Chicago Cubs

miami marlins vs chicago cubs match player stats

Miami Marlins

  • Corey Dickerson: The Marlins' veteran outfielder leads the team with a robust batting average of .317, boasting a remarkable on-base percentage of .393. His ability to get on base consistently poses a significant threat to the Cubs' pitching staff.
  • Brian Anderson: Anderson, a versatile infielder, has been a consistent force at the plate, hitting for an average of .284 with 5 home runs. His knack for driving in runs makes him a key player in the Marlins' offense.
  • Jazz Chisholm Jr.: The dynamic shortstop has emerged as a rising star, showcasing a .286 batting average and impressive speed on the basepaths. His ability to steal bases and create scoring opportunities will be crucial for the Marlins' success.

Chicago Cubs

  • Seiya Suzuki: The highly touted Japanese import has made an immediate impact, leading the Cubs with a .320 batting average and 5 home runs. His power and contact skills make him a formidable threat in the lineup.
  • Patrick Wisdom: Wisdom has emerged as a reliable power source, hitting 4 home runs and driving in 10 runs this season. His ability to hit for extra bases will be essential for the Cubs' offensive production.
  • Ian Happ: Happ, a versatile utility player, has been a steady contributor, batting .278 with 3 home runs and 9 RBIs. His versatility and ability to play multiple positions will be valuable assets for the Cubs.

Pitching Duel: Miami Marlins vs. Chicago Cubs

Miami Marlins

  • Trevor Rogers: The young left-hander is the ace of the Marlins' pitching staff, boasting a 2.24 ERA and 33 strikeouts in 25.1 innings pitched. His impressive fastball-changeup combination will pose a significant challenge to the Cubs' batters.
  • Sandy Alcantara: Alcantara, a breakout star in 2021, has continued to excel this season, posting a 2.35 ERA and 28 strikeouts in 23 innings pitched. His pinpoint control and ability to throw multiple pitches for strikes will be key in shutting down the Cubs' offense.
  • Anthony Bender: Bender, a rising right-hander, has emerged as a reliable bullpen arm, recording a 2.19 ERA and 11 strikeouts in 12.1 innings pitched. His versatility, allowing him to pitch in multiple roles, will be crucial for the Marlins' bullpen.

Chicago Cubs

  • Justin Steele: Steele, a left-hander, has impressed in his sophomore season, posting a 2.58 ERA and 29 strikeouts in 24.1 innings pitched. His deceptive changeup has been a significant weapon for the Cubs' pitching staff.
  • Keegan Thompson: Thompson, a versatile right-hander, has pitched well as both a starter and a reliever, recording a 3.32 ERA and 27 strikeouts in 20.1 innings pitched. His ability to throw multiple innings and provide stability will be essential for the Cubs' pitching staff.
  • Rowan Wick: Wick, a flame-throwing right-hander, has been a force out of the bullpen, posting a 2.25 ERA and 17 strikeouts in 12 innings pitched. His ability to close out games will be crucial for the Cubs' success.
